Brick Foundation Sealing in Birmingham, AL
Brick foundation sealing services involve applying specialized protective coatings to the exterior surfaces of brick foundations. This process helps prevent water infiltration, reduce moisture-related damage, and enhance the durability of the foundation. Projects typically include sealing residential basement or crawl space foundations,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or moisture exposure, to safeguard against cracking, shifting, or deterioration caused by water penetration.
Homeowners considering foundation sealing often want to understand the benefits of moisture protection, the types of sealants used, and how the service can help preserve the structural integrity of their property. It’s also common to inquire about the condition of existing brickwork, preparation requirements before sealing, and whether the service is suitable for older or weathered brick surfaces. Proper sealing can contribute to maintaining a stable foundation and preventing costly repairs in the future.

Brick Foundation Sealing Questions
What is brick foundation sealing? Brick foundation s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ent moisture from penetrating the brickwork and causing damage.
Why is sealing important for brick foundations? Sealing helps reduce water infiltration, which can lead to cracks, deterioration, and structural issues over time.
What types of projects typically require brick foundation sealing? Sealing is often recommended for homes with visible cracks, moisture problems, or signs of aging in the brick foundation.
How does sealing benefit property owners? Proper sealing can help extend the lifespan of the foundation, improve energy efficiency, and maintain the property's value.
